Earth Day

Yesterday it was Earth Day. Earth Day is an annual day on which events are held worldwide to increase awareness and appreciation of the Earth's natural environment. It is celebrated in more than 175 countries every year. In 2009, the United Nations designated April 22 International Mother Earth Day.

International Childrens' Book Day

Since 1967, on or around Hans Christian Andersen's birthday, 2 April, International Children's Book Day (ICBD) is celebrated to inspire a love of reading and to call attention to children's books.

Each year a different National Section of IBBY has the opportunity to be the international sponsor of ICBD. It (this year it is Mexico) decides upon a theme and invites a prominent author from the host country to write a message to the children of the world and a well-known illustrator to design a poster. These materials are used in different ways to promote books and reading. Many IBBY Sections promote ICBD through the media and organize activities in schools and public libraries.

INEBI and BHINEBI. CLIL approach in the Basque Country

During our last visit to Barakaldo as members of our ARCE project, we have been introduced to these two basque CLIL programmes.

INEBI is a content based approach to teaching and learning second languages in primary education (primary 1 to 6). It provides material (organized by level for quick and easy access), that covers Social Science and Natural Science contents.

BHINEBI provides material organized by subjects and level for quick and easy access in secondary education. It covers such contents as Geography, Visual Arts and Design, Philosophy, Religion, Politics, Science, Literature, History and Music.

Celebrating World Poetry Day

During its 30th session held in Paris in October-November 1999, UNESCO (the United Nations Educational, Scientific and Cultural Organization) decided to proclaim 21 March as World Poetry Day. The purpose of the day is to promote the reading, writing, publishing and teaching of poetry throughout the world and, as the UNESCO session declaring the day says, to "give fresh recognition and impetus to national, regional and international poetry movements".

UNESCO encourages the Member States to take an active part in celebrating the World Poetry Day, at both local and national level, with the active participation of National Commissions, NGOs and the public and private institutions concerned (schools, municipalities, poetic communities, museums, cultural associations, publishing houses, local authorities, etc.).
